Thieves stole a famous Winston Churchill portrait from an Ottawa hotel in late 2021. The 1941 portrait was replaced with a forgery and went unnoticed for over 6 months.
Jeffrey Wood was sentenced to two years less a day on Monday for the theft of The Roaring Lion from Ottawa's Château Laurier hotel between Christmas 2021 and early January 2022.

The Churchill portrait was pivotal to the career of Mr. Karsh, who died in 2002. It appeared on the cover of Life magazine and has been widely reproduced since it was taken in 1941.
